The American company Chevron announced that the easing of US sanctions allows it to sell its oil in Venezuela.

On Saturday, the US Treasury issued a six-month license allowing Chevron to produce and refine oil in cooperation with the Venezuelan PdVSA, and to supply the joint venture’s products to the US market.

“The issuance of the license means that Chevron is now able to sell oil currently produced through the company’s joint venture assets,” the company said in a statement. “We are committed to maintaining a constructive presence in this country and continue to support humanitarian action.” social investment programs.

He also confirmed that he would establish business in Venezuela within the framework set by the US authorities.

The company added that “the decision of the Office of Foreign Assets Control of the US Treasury increases the transparency of the Venezuelan oil sector.”

The US administration said that the decision to ease the sanctions imposed against Venezuela is due to the progress in the dialogue between the Venezuelan authorities and the opposition.
